A couple of the pundits here said that Tonga 'deserved' to win. Utter cobblers. England played Bennett style for 70 minutes and were clearly the better team. Had England not decided they'd won the game and it was time to think about the final that would probably have ended up 20-0.

As it was England took their foot off the gas, Tonga got a sniff and all of a sudden England's defence looks like a bunch of Under 9s, with players bunched and chasing the ball individually. There was one point near the end when Tonga moved the ball right where they were tackled, and anybody could see that they were going to try to move it left fast in the next tackle, but England's entire team were barley spread past the centre of the field. They were so congested there they had no chance to properly slide as a unit.

If I were Bennett I'd be very disappointed in the fact that none of the senior players took charge and got the team to regroup, especially after Tonga's second try. If we had as bad a five minute spell as that at any time vs Aus we'll also let in 2-3 tries.
